Understanding Team Needs in Leadership: A Guide to Need Theories

CO2 Business Leadership

Understanding Team Needs in Leadership: Maslow’s Hierarchy of Needs Abraham Maslow’s well-known theory suggests that humans prioritize lower-order needs (like safety and physiological needs) before higher-order needs (such as social, esteem, and self-actualization). Existence Needs: Physiological & Safety Needs.

Toxic Work Environments | N2Growth Blog

N2Growth Blog

The fuel for toxicity is conflict not resolution, ego not humility, self-interest not service above self, gossip & innuendo not truth, social & corporate climbing not team-building, and the list could go on. Real leaders will quickly coach toxic team members to a healthy place, or show them the door - there is no third option.
